Season 20 (also known as Wild 'N Out: 20) is the twentieth season of the improv comedy show, Wild 'N Out, on VH1. This season was reverted back to the "Red Team vs Black Team" format, where host Nick Cannon led the Red Team, and the celebrity guest led the Black Team. The season premiered on July 6, 2023 with "Katt Williams/Mark Curry/Michael Blackson/Justina Valentine", and concluded on September 28, 2023 with two episodes: "Lil Duval" and "Joe Albanese/Jilly Anais/Michael Blackson".
Production[]
Production of the twentieth and nineteenth seasons took place at Trilith Studios in Fayetteville, Georgia. Production commenced from August 30, 2022 to September 23, 2022.

Trivia[]
- This is the tenth season for cast members Tim Chantarangsu, Corey Charron, Bobb'e J. Thompson, and B. Simone.
- This is the first and only season where Nick Cannon does not appear in every episode.
- This is the first season where current cast members host episodes as the Red Team Captain.
- This is the first season since Season 14 that features Nick Cannon leading the Red Team.
- This is the first season since Season 14 to feature the Red and Black teams.
- This is the second season to not feature any new cast members.
- This is the third season to feature DC Young Fly and Justina Valentine as "Musical Guests".
- This is the fourth season to feature an hour long episode.
- This is the fourth season to not feature any new games.
- This is the fifth season to feature "Battle of the Sexes".
- This season features a new theme song.
- There was controversy between cast member B. Simone and singer DaniLeigh, where DaniLeigh asked the producers if B. Simone could be removed from her episode.
- A week before his passing, rapper Coolio was scheduled to appear as a Team Captain for the Black Team and perform "Gangsta's Paradise", but had to cancel at the last minute due to traveling issues.
